Transaction 637690fc2dcf84570e4a1b59c0f032152673091e8b37f56447dd4d39eb26b23d
1 Input
1 Output
-
637690fc2dcf84570e4a1b59c0f032152673091e8b37f56447dd4d39eb26b23d:0
- value
- 68191174
- script pubkey
- OP_0 OP_PUSHBYTES_20 6987f24eaf37de4a931f88af7d695320dc8e161e
- address
- bc1qdxrlyn40xl0y4ycl3zhh662nyrwgu9s77j45sk